The housing market has been on fire for several years now, with prices soaring to record highs. But some experts are warning that a bust could be on the horizon. There are several factors that could contribute to a market downturn, including rising interest rates, inflation, and a potential recession.
- Moreover, some analysts believe that the recent surge in housing prices is unsustainable and that a correction is overdue.
- However, others argue that the fundamentals of the housing market are strong and that a crash is unlikely.
It's difficult to say for sure whether or not a housing market crash is looming. The future remains to be seen. But it's important to stay informed and be prepared for any eventuality

A Housing Correction Looms: When Will Prices Fall?
Predicting the future of home prices is a tricky business like navigating a minefield. While experts often point to factors such as interest rates, inventory levels, and economic trends, the real estate market can be notoriously volatile. Some analysts are forecasting a drop in home prices in the near future, citing concerns such as high inflation, rising mortgage rates, and potential economic slowdowns. Conversely, others argue that the housing market remains strong and that prices will continue to increase.
Ultimately, when home prices will drop and by how much remains uncertain. It's is a question that many homeowners, investors are pondering.

Housing Market Trends to Watch in 2025
Predicting the future of the housing market is always a gamble, but there are some indicators that suggest where things might be heading in 2025. One trend to watch is the growing popularity of remote work, which could lead to more homeowners seeking out homes in rural areas. Additionally, there is a growing emphasis on energy-efficiency features in new construction, as homeowners become more conscious of their environmental impact.
